Wake Up Ready: Tips and Strategies to Rise Early Each Morning

Having low motivation to get up early in the morning, hitting the snooze button, while saying I didn't sleep well. These tips and strategies will help you get up and crank up your motivation level so that you are ready to jump out of bed and ready yourself to take the day ahead.


Set Your Intention and Plan Your Day Before Bed:


Plan Your Day


Making up your mind, planning, visualizing and affirming something before you go to bed can help you create a positive expectation and help with the motivation to get up as the alarm beeps for the next morning.

Move your Alarm Clock far away from your Bed:


Alarm Clock
This means that you will have to get out of your bed and move your body to do that. Motion creates energy, so getting out of your bed and walking across the room to turn off your alarm naturally helps you wake up.

People mostly place their alarm clocks near their beds. But that's perfect if you want to hit the snooze button and go back to sleep.

Directly go to the washroom:


washroom


Don't check your mobile, don't check your emails, don't check your social media, after turning off your alarm, go directly to the bathroom, splash some warm water on your face, and brush your teeth. Time to Hydrate:


Hydrate


After brushing, your mouth is fresh, so it's time to hydrate. After seven to eight hours of sleep without water, you will be mildly dehydrated, which causes fatigue. So drinking a full glass of water is crucial to get you fresh and going.

Bonus Tips:

Make a bedtime Affirmation and keep it next to your bed to help set your intentions each night before you go to sleep. Set a timer for your bedroom light to turn on automatically and also set an auto on a timer for your bedroom heater, these will help reduce friction that keeps you in your bed.
